> What INFORMAL READING INVENTORY (IRI) do you prefer? I have used the
> Stieglitz, Burns & Roe, Silvarolli and a few from reading textbooks.
> We use
> the DRA for grades 1 and 2 at present but we switch to the IRI in
> grades 3
> and 4, largely because of time constraints.
>
> I have seen some reviews of Burns and Roe in which people feel some of
> the
> passages are very dated. The Silvarolli (in my opinion) is the least
> accurate. I like the Stieglitz for a number of reasons. Any thoughts
> about
> any of these or other IRIs? And what about the QRI? How does it
> compare?
